What I’m seeing is: Plugin could not be activated because it triggered a fatal error. Warning : require_once(/home/vol9_5/epizy.com/epiz_24250188/ilearning.epizy.com/htdocs/wp-content/plugins/woocommerce/includes/legacy/abstract-wc-legacy-product.php): failed to open stream: No such file or directory in /home/vol9_5/epizy.com/epiz_24250188/ilearning.epizy.com/htdocs/wp-content/plugins/woocommerce/includes/abstracts/abstract-wc-product.php on line 16
**I’m using this software:**Wordpress, InfinityFree Hosting, Astra Theme
Additional information: I created a subdomain website under one of my main accounts. I could install woocommerce for my main domain website but with the subdomain website, it triggered an error, can you please look into this?
You need to force remove it by going with a FTP client on ilearning.epizy.com/htdocs/wp-content/plugins/ and removing woocommerce folder. After that, download a fresh copy of it from here, extract it on your computer, and upload the new woocommerce folder on the same folder you used to delete the corrupted WooCommerce. After that, login to your WordPress Panel, and enable the plugin as usual.
